Clues You May Need Animal Control Services
Identifying the clues that suggest a need for animal removal services is crucial for maintaining a safe home environment. Homeowners should be attentive for strange noises in attics or walls, which may suggest the existence of pests. Additionally, unexplained damage to property, such as gnawed wires or chewed furniture, can be a definite indication of an animal infestation.
Spotting droppings or footsteps near the home is another signal that professional intervention might be required. Foul odors, typically stemming from animal waste or dead animals, can further indicate a serious matter. Moreover, sightings of wildlife in or around the property, especially during the daylight hours, may indicate that animals are encroaching on living spaces. Prompt attention to these signs can prevent more significant problems and guarantee the safety and comfort of the property. Calling in professionals at the first signal of trouble can reduce risks and restore peace of mind.

Recommendations for Stopping Future Wildlife Difficulties
Preventing future wildlife troubles takes proactive efforts and a watchful eye for potential entry openings. Homeowners need to regularly inspect their properties for spaces in foundations, attics, and vents, sealing any openings to prevent animal intrusion. Proper maintenance of landscaping is vital; overgrown vegetation can provide shelter for pests. Additionally, securely storing food and garbage in animal-proof containers minimizes attraction to wildlife.
Installing fencing can also act as a deterrent, especially around vegetable patches or animal enclosures. It is essential to keep exterior areas clean by removing waste and mess that may shelter animals. Informing family members about animal consciousness and the importance of reporting sightings can encourage a preventative mindset. Ultimately, consistent vigilance and maintenance of the property create an inhospitable space for wildlife, greatly reducing the likelihood of future infestations and guaranteeing tranquility for homeowners.
